Key Responsibilities:
- Lead, motivate, and supervise a team during mulch installations and other landscaping projects.
- Plan daily schedules, assign tasks, and monitor progress to ensure projects are completed efficiently and on time.
- Blow down 50–70 yards of mulch per day, maintaining speed, precision, and quality.
- Maintain a safe working environment by enforcing safety protocols and training crew members in proper equipment use.
- Perform quality inspections to ensure all work meets company standards and exceeds client expectations.
- Assist with landscaping tasks including lawn care, pruning, planting, and irrigation installation or repair.
- Provide mentorship and hands-on training to your crew in horticultural techniques and industry best practices.
- Communicate effectively with clients and team members to address questions, concerns, and project specifications.
